    Living with Arthritis

    Living with Arthritis

    Osteoarthritis (OA) is the most common form of arthritis and effects over 30 million people in the US alone. Worldwide, 9.6% of men and 18% of women over the age of 60 have osteoarthritis. 80% of those people have limited movement and 25% are unable to perform daily activities.     Minimizing Added Sugars in Your Diet

    Minimizing Added Sugars in Your Diet

    Sugar in your diet can be naturally occurring or added. Natural sugars are found in products such as milk and fruit. Added sugars include sugars and syrups that are put into foods during preparation, processing or even added at the table.
